Abstract

Official abstract text for this publication.

A process for purifying 2,5-dichlorophenol, the process comprising the steps of distillation and subsequent crystallization.

First claim

Opening claim text (preview).

The invention claimed is: 1. A process for purifying 2,5-dichlorophenol, the process comprising the steps of: (i) subjecting a mixture (M) comprising 2,5-dichlorophenol, 2,4-dichlorophenol and optionally 3,4-dichlorophenol to distillation to obtain a distillate (D), and (ii) subjecting the distillate (D) to a melt crystallization step to obtain a crystalline fraction (C) and a mother liquor (L). 2. The process of claim 1 , further comprising the step of: (iii) combining a composition obtained from the mother liquor (L) in step (ii) with a feed (F), comprising 2,5-dichlorophenol, 2,4-dichlorophenol and optionally 3,4-dichlorophenol, to obtain mixture (M) to be subjected to distillation in step (i). 3. The process of claim 2 , wherein the feed (F) is obtained from hydrolyzing 1,2,4-trichlorophenol in the presence of an alkali metal hydroxide or alkali metal alkoxide. 4. The process of claim 2 , wherein the mixture (M) and/or the feed (F) comprises 40 to 95 wt.-% of 2,5-dichlorophenol; 5 to 60 wt.-% of 2,4-dichlorophenol; and optionally 0 to 30 wt.-% of 3,4-dichlorophenol. 5. The process of claim 1 , wherein the distillate (D) obtained in step (i) comprises 50 to 95 wt.-% of 2,5-dichlorophenol. 6. The process of claim 1 , wherein the crystalline fraction (C) obtained in step (ii) comprises 80 to 99.9 wt.-% of 2,5-dichlorophenol. 7. The process of claim 1 , wherein the distillation step (i) is carried out in a distillation column at a pressure of 5 kPa to 25 kPa, and a bottom temperature of 60° C. to 230° C. 8. The process of claim 1 , wherein the melt crystallization step (ii) is carried out using layer melt crystallization or suspension melt crystallization. 9. The process of claim 8 , wherein the step of suspension melt crystallization further comprises a step of separating the obtained crystals from the melt. 10. The process of claim 2 , wherein 2,5-dichlorophenol is present in the mixture (M) and/or the feed (F) in an amount of 50 to 85 wt.-%. 11. The process of claim 10 , wherein 2,5-dichlorophenol is present in the mixture (M) and/or the feed (F) in an amount of 40 to 80 wt-%. 12. The process of claim 11 , wherein 2,4-dichlorophenol is present in the mixture (M) and/or the feed (F) in an amount of 10 to 40 wt-%. 13. The process of claim 12 , wherein 2,4-dichlorophenol is present in the mixture (M) and/or the feed (F) in an amount of 10 to 20 wt.-%.
